Covid, canceled Japanese F1 GP

The Japanese F1 GP has been canceled from the 2021 calendar. This was announced by Liberty Media in a note in which it emphasizes that the persistence of the Covid-19 pandemic has forced the Japanese government to cancel the event scheduled for 10 October.

The Japanese one is the third GP of the season to jump due to Covid after Singapore and Australia. F1, according to the press release, is already working to replace the canceled appointments with new Grands Prix. Details will be provided in the coming weeks.
